CD duplication is a very popular way of producing small runs of discs. The big advantage of this process lies in its timescale and the ability to produce a sample print for approval before the full run commences. CD duplication prices depend very much on the quantities involved, and the quality that the company providing your CD duplication services strives to deliver. Recently, cheap CD duplication has led to a boom in musicians promoting their songs without the aid of a record label, especially since CD duplication and printing can produce high-quality results. CD duplication uk services can vary from high-resolution inkjet printing, to labels, thermal printing and thermal transfer print as well as screen printing.

CD DVD Duplication
DVD duplication also remains dominant, despite the emergence of new formats, CD/DVD duplication has not experienced any slowdown or loss in market share. With the advantage of high install base and high compatibility, companies most often opt for CD/DVD duplication when delivering content to the end-user.

CD DVD Replication
For those looking to produce in greater quantities, you may want to look into CD DVD replication, a full manufacturing process that is far more cost effective per unit. CD DVD replication is most often useful for runs of 1,000 units and over, the CD replication in the UK often focusing on promotional releases. DVD replication is becoming more popular as individual content creation increases, driving prices down across the board.
